Protect Your Home's Foundation

When gutters fail, water flows off your roof directly to the ground surrounding your home. Over time, this concentrated pooling of water damages your foundation, cracks walkways, rots exterior wood, and washes away landscaping. A functional, well-pitched gutter system directs all storm water safely away from your home's structural framing.

  • Prevent foundation issues: Keep soil levels stable around structural concrete slab points.
  • Avert wood & fascia rot: Prevent overflowing water from soaking behind roof soffit borders.
  • Protect landscaping: Stop sheets of water from drowning plants and washing away flowerbeds.

Custom Gutter Installation

Standard gutters have seams every few feet, which eventually leak and sag. ACO installs custom-fabricated seamless aluminum gutters. We bring our fabrication machine to your house, roll-form the metal sheets to the exact length of your roofline, and secure them with heavy-duty internal hangers. This results in a sleek, leak-free system that protects your property for decades.

Available in a broad variety of colors to complement your home's trim, fascia, and roof shingles.

Prompt Gutter Repair & Realignment

Are your gutters sagging, pulling away from the wood, or leaking at the corner joints? We don't always recommend full replacements. If the gutter material is in good shape, we can replace broken spikes with heavy-duty structural screws, re-secure sagging points, clean out rust, seal corner leaks, and realign the system to ensure correct water pitch toward downspouts.

Debris Clearing & Cleaning

Clogged gutters are useless. When leaves, twigs, and shingle granules accumulate, they weigh down your gutters and cause overflow. Our team clears all debris, flushes downspouts to guarantee free water flow, and inspects the hangers and seams. We recommend regular cleanings twice a year—especially in late autumn and spring—to keep your drainage working smoothly.

Types of Gutters We Offer

We provide multiple styles and metals to match your home's architecture.

Seamless Aluminum

The most popular choice. Rust-free, affordable, custom-fabricated on-site, and available in multiple colors.

K-Style Gutters

Features a decorative crown-mold shape that matches modern roofing edges and holds high volumes of storm water.

Half-Round Gutters

A classic semi-circular profile that suits historic, Spanish-style, or rustic brick custom residences.

Copper Gutters

Unmatched luxury appeal. Highly durable, natural weathering patina, and adds value to premium custom structures.
